Lithane indications The medicine is used in treating mania and hypomania or in patients who have recurrent bipolar depression. Lithane could also be used in other purposes not mentioned here. Lithane warnings Talk to your doctor first before taking Lithane if you have Addison's disease, cardiovascular insufficiency, renal insufficiency, and untreated hypothyroidism. Elderly are known to be more sensitive to the drug. For this reason, they might need lesser dose than young adults might. Talk to your doctor about this. It is not advisable to give or use Lithane as a treatment to children or adolescents. Talk to your doctor first before taking this medication. Before taking Lithane, inform your doctor if you have infectious disease such as influenza, colds, gastroenteritis and urinary infections. This medicine is known to cause harm to an unborn baby. Talk to your doctor first before talking Lithane if you are pregnant or could become pregnant during the treatment. This drug is known to pass into breast milk. Lithane side effects Some of the side effects of Lithane are vertigo, muscle weakness, nausea, mild gastrointestinal effects and dazed feeling. These side effects usually disappear after stabilization. Other side effects such as fine hand tremors, polyuria and mild thirst; weight gain or oedema; hypercalcaemia, hypermagnesaemia and hyperparathyroidism; and skin problems may also occur. Talk to your doctor in the soonest possible time if you experience any of the said side effects. Some of the side effects of the medicine when used in a long-term basis are thyroid function disturbances like goitre, Hypothyroidism and thyrotoxicosis; polyuria or polydipsia, renal function; and memory impairment. Gastrointestinal side effects such as increasing anorexia, diarrhea and vomiting and central nervous system side effect like drowsiness and ataxia, dysarthria, coarse tremor, blurred vision, muscle weakness, lack of co-ordination, tinnitus and muscle twitching may also occur. Stop taking Lithane and look for emergency medical attention or contact your doctor immediately if you experience any of the said side effects. Other side effects not mentioned here may also occur. Talk to your doctor if you experience any unusual or bothersome side effects. Lithane drug reactions Some drugs that may affect Lithane are selective serotonin re-uptake inhibitors, metronidazole, tetracyclines, topiramate, non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s, ACE inhibitors, thiazide diuretics, spironolactone, frusemide, angiotensin-II receptor antagonists, other drugs that affect electrolyte balance, xanthines, sodium bicarbonate and sodium chloride containing products, psyllium or ispaghula husk, urea, mannitol, acetazolamide, neuroleptics, cxalcum channel blockers, carbamazepine or phenytoin, methyldopa, lithium, thioridazine, and iodide. Talk to your doctor first before taking the drug if you are taking any of the said medications. If you are taking any of the said medications, your doctor might not allow you to take Lithane, adjust your dose, or require you a special monitoring during the treatment.
